What Elementary (A2) Italian means
At A2 Italian, learners can handle simple routine exchanges and describe familiar aspects of everyday life.
Describe your routine
Di solito vado al lavoro in autobus e torno a casa alle sei.
I usually go to work by bus and return home at six.
Make a simple plan
Vuoi andare al cinema sabato pomeriggio?
Would you like to go to the cinema on Saturday afternoon?
Talk about the recent past
Ieri ho cenato con degli amici e poi abbiamo fatto una passeggiata.
Yesterday I had dinner with friends and then we went for a walk.

About this course
The course develops Italian for situations involving employment, career histories, minor health problems, pharmacies and everyday advice. Learners practise discussing past habits and childhood experiences, while building vocabulary around work, health and the body. Teaching combines spoken interaction, role-plays and group activities with structured study of grammar and pronunciation. Topics include the imperfect tense, regular and irregular tu imperatives, verbs expressing the beginning, continuation or ending of actions, and the use of da for place. The teacher conducts the class in Italian to develop comprehension and listening.
What you'll learn
- Discuss jobs, career paths and the advantages and disadvantages of different occupations
- Describe minor health issues and symptoms, and seek or give advice about remedies and stress
- Use regular and irregular tu imperatives to formulate instructions
- Talk about past habits and situations from childhood using the imperfect tense
- Apply vocabulary related to work, health, the body and everyday expressions
- Use verbs such as cominciare a, finire di and continuare a, and use da to indicate place
